Atmospheric indie smart-pop trio that channels melodic Beatles classicism & lush 80's Euro-pop, but with a dash of Americana thrown in for good measure.

author: Joe Wiesner
                            
I've made the mistake - and never seem to learn from it - about excitedly buying a CD having heard but one killer track and making assumptions about the rest. I've got a half-dozen CDs sitting right here from the likes of Chalk Farm, Vertical Horizon, etc. that are going for 75 cents on half.com. I frankly don't know what to do with 'em. Even that ONE track doesn't get me anymore. That, happily, will NOT be a problem with Tonefarmer's Where You Go EP. There's a certain depth to each track that ages well. Maybe not Radiohead-ambitious, mind you, but quite a bit more accessible, and certainly way out in front of anything being perpetrated on us by the major labels these days. Get this disc. You'll keep it.
